The amount of water vapor in air expressed as a percentage of the air samples total holding capacity
Relative Humidity
A measurement of water vapor weight in a given volume of air. Measured in grains per pound (GPP)
Humidity Ratio
Temperature at which air can hold no more moisture
Dew point
relative humidity at dew point is 100%
Pressure of water vapor on surrounding surfaces and objects, measured in inches of mercury. Directly related to GPP and dew point
Vapor Pressure
Movement of water vapor through a material
Vapor Diffusion
A measure of the ability for vapor to travel through a material
Permeance
Material with a permeance of 1.0 or less
Vapor Barrier
Difference in GPP of the air entering and air leaving a dehumidifier - an indicator of dehumidifier performance
Grain Depression
System of drying where the structure is kept closed to outside air. Used because of security reasons and/or unfavorable outdoor air, or when access to outdoor air is prevented
Closed drying system
System of drying where outdoor air is used. Among other considerations, outdoor air should have a significantly lower GPP than the indoor air
Open drying system
System of drying where some outdoor air is used with dehumidification to accelerate drying. System can include flooding the air, negative pressurization and/or utilizing a small opening to the outside.
Combination drying system
A chemical which reduces the amount of microorganism’s on a surface, but does not eliminate all microbial life
Sanitizer
A chemical which kills all forms of microbial life, but not the microbial spores.
Disinfectant
A chemical which kills all forms of microbial life, including their spores
Sterilizer
Percentage of moisture in wood when compared to an oven-dried sample. Expressed in percentage of the drying weight.
Moisture content
Materials that readily absorb or release moisture based on the surrounding humidity
Hygroscopic
Association of home appliance manufacturers. Publishes test results for water removal of dehumidifiers at conditions of 80 degrees/60%RH over 24 hours
AHAM
A guide word in an IICRC standard that means that the practice of procedure is mandatory due to natural law or legal requirements.
Shall
A guide word in an IICRC standard that means that the practice is a critical procedure to be followed, but not required by law or legal requirements
Should
A guide word in an IICRC standard that means that the practice is advised or suggested, while not a part of the standard of care
Recommended

Differences in moisture in different areas of a material
Moisture content gradient
Liquid changing to a vapor
Evaporation
Vapor changing to a liquid
Condensation
